How Exfoliation Revolutionizes Your Skin Texture and Tone

The primary goal of any effective skincare routine is to support the body’s natural renewal process. By assisting with dead skin cell removal, you effectively clear the slate for fresh, healthy cells to emerge, resulting in a complexion that feels like silk and looks remarkably younger.

Accelerating cell turnover

As we age, our natural cell turnover rate slows down significantly. In our youth, skin regenerates every 28 days, but by our 30s and 40s, that process can take 45 days or longer. Regular exfoliation acts as a catalyst, signaling to the deeper layers of the dermis that it is time to produce new cells. This constant renewal helps to soften the appearance of fine lines and ensures that your skin remains resilient and firm.

Brightening dull complexions

Dullness is almost always caused by light reflecting unevenly off a surface of dry, dead cells. When you remove that debris, you reveal the “new” skin underneath which has a much smoother surface. This allows light to bounce off your face and body evenly, creating that coveted “lit from within” glow that many people try to achieve with makeup. For our clients in sunny Florida and California, maintaining this brightness is the key to a year-round summer aesthetic.

Pro Tip: Always follow your exfoliation session with a high-quality SPF. New skin cells are more sensitive to UV rays, and protecting your fresh glow is essential for preventing premature aging.

The Secret Connection Between Exfoliation and Flawless Waxing Results

At Natura Spa, we have performed thousands of treatments over our 15-year history, and we have noticed a clear pattern. Clients who prioritize exfoliating before waxing consistently report less discomfort during their appointments and significantly better long-term results.

Why we recommend exfoliating 48 hours before your appointment

Timing is everything when it comes to prep. We suggest a gentle exfoliation two days before your visit to ensure the skin is clean and clear of debris. This window allows your skin to recover from the exfoliation itself so it isn’t overly sensitive when the wax is applied. By removing the buildup of oils and dead cells, the wax can adhere directly to the hair rather than the skin, which makes for a much cleaner and more efficient pull.

Lifting trapped hairs for a cleaner pull

Sometimes, tiny hairs can become “glued” to the skin by a layer of dry cells. If these hairs aren’t freed before your appointment, the wax might skip over them, leading to those frustrating “missed patches.” Exfoliating gently coaxes these stubborn hairs to stand up, ensuring that even the shortest, finest strands are removed from the root during your Professional Brazilian Waxing session.

Pro Tip: Never exfoliate immediately before or the day after your waxing appointment. Your skin needs a 48-hour “buffer zone” on both sides of a wax to prevent irritation or over-sensitization.

Saying Goodbye to Painful Ingrown Hairs Forever

Perhaps the most celebrated advantage of a consistent routine is its effectiveness in preventing ingrown hairs. These painful, red bumps occur when a hair curls back or grows sideways into the skin, often because the follicle opening is blocked by debris.

Clearing the path for new hair growth

When hair is removed at the root, the new hair that grows back is often finer and softer. This “baby hair” sometimes lacks the strength to push through a thick layer of dead skin. By keeping the surface of the skin thin and pliable through regular exfoliation, you effectively “open the door” for the new hair to emerge straight and clear, preventing the inflammation associated with trapped growth.

Reducing inflammation and redness

If you already struggle with bumps, gentle exfoliation can help soothe the area by releasing trapped sebum and bacteria. When combined with a professional Post-waxing aftercare guide, regular maintenance ensures that your bikini line or legs remain clear, calm, and ready for the beach. This is especially important for our clients who enjoy the active, outdoor lifestyles of the West Coast and the Sunshine State.

Pro Tip: If you have an active, inflamed ingrown hair, avoid harsh physical scrubs. Instead, use a gentle topical treatment with salicylic acid to dissolve the blockage without further traumatizing the skin.

Choosing the Right Method for Your Unique Skin Type

Not all exfoliation is created equal, and using the wrong method can actually lead to micro-tears or increased sensitivity. Understanding the difference between hot wax vs cold wax and how they interact with different skin types is the first step toward a safe and effective regimen.

Gentle chemical exfoliants for sensitive areas

Chemical exfoliation uses Alpha Hydroxy Acids (AHAs) or Beta Hydroxy Acids (BHAs) to dissolve the “glue” that holds dead cells together. For sensitive areas like the face or the bikini line, we often recommend gentle enzymes or lactic acid. These provide a deep clean without the need for abrasive scrubbing, making them ideal for those with reactive skin or those prone to hyperpigmentation.

When to use physical scrubs safely

Physical exfoliation involves using a tool, like a sugar scrub, a loofah, or a dry brush, to manually buff away debris. This is excellent for tougher skin on the legs, elbows, and knees. The key is to use light, circular motions—let the product do the work for you. At Natura Spa, we advocate for high-quality, professional-grade scrubs that use round beads rather than jagged shells to ensure the skin remains intact and healthy.

Pro Tip: If your skin feels tight, itchy, or looks shiny (but isn’t oily) after exfoliating, you may be overdoing it. Dial back to once a week until your skin barrier recovers.

Maximizing the Absorption of Your Favorite Skincare Products

One of the most overlooked smooth skin benefits is how exfoliation enhances the rest of your beauty cabinet. If you are investing in high-quality serums and lotions, you want to make sure they are actually reaching the layers of skin where they can do the most good.

Removing the barrier of dead cells

Imagine trying to water a garden through a thick layer of plastic wrap—that is essentially what you are doing when you apply moisturizer over unexfoliated skin. By removing the barrier of dead cells, you create a direct pathway for hydration. This means your skin stays moisturized for longer and looks significantly more “plump” and hydrated.

Getting more value from your serums and moisturizers

When your pores are clear and the surface is smooth, your skin becomes like a sponge. You will find that you actually need to use less product to achieve the same results, saving you money in the long run. Whether you are using a vitamin C serum for brightening or a rich body butter for hydration, exfoliation ensures you get 100% of the benefits from every drop. For those interested in deeper rejuvenation, this also prepares the skin perfectly for Professional facial treatments.

Pro Tip: Apply your moisturizer to slightly damp skin immediately after exfoliating and showering to “lock in” the maximum amount of moisture.
